Meme 梗圖倉庫
梗圖產生器
網友創作區
GIF 與其他
梗圖資料庫
素材資源庫
GIF 梗圖產生器
GIF 網友創作區
GIF 梗圖資料庫
文字圖產生器
街頭字典
話題部落
寫作小館
迷因音效板
NEW
達人清單
問答廣場
語錄基地
梗圖資料 API
Instagram
FB 粉絲專頁
LINE 圖戰幫手
使用者條款
創作與討論規範
街頭字典
話題部落
寫作小館
迷因音效板
NEW
搜尋
升級 Pro 會員
登入
註冊
搜尋關鍵字
×
搜尋
升級 Pro 會員,贊助梗圖倉庫,移除全站廣告!
有看不懂的流行語嗎?
×
很多梗圖的單字、用詞根本看不懂嗎?
可以使用本站的「
街頭字典
」查詢意思!
查詢街頭字典
搜尋
或者直接到話題部落發問也可以!
前往話題部落發問
部落首頁
部落清單
搜尋貼文
搜尋部落
我加入的
我管理的
部落首頁
部落清單
搜尋貼文
搜尋部落
更多
我加入的
我管理的
搜尋貼文
×
搜尋
搜尋部落
×
搜尋
程式設計討論
/t/programming
版主置頂
站長阿川
🌏
·
3年前
關於程式設計討論專區~
哈囉大家~不知道有沒有跟站長一樣~程式相關的從業人員呢~ 討論區文章格式,是支援程式碼的唷~ 歡迎大家多多利用這個專區,來互相交流~ 作為功能示範,站長貼一段梗圖倉庫的程式碼~ 是一段很簡單的熱門分數演算法~ ``` function refreshTrendingScore() { if ($this->approved_at < \Carbon\Carbon::now()->subHours( 24 * trending_image_beginning_live_days() + $this->total_like_count * trending_image_extra_hours_per_like() )) { $this->trending_score = 0; $this->save(); return; } $score = 0; if ($this->user_id != 0) { $score += 100; if ($this->user->intro) $score += 2; if ($this->user->photo) $score += 2; if ($this->user->created_at >= \Carbon\Carbon::now()->subDays(2) || $this->user->wtf_total_count < 4) { $score += 4; } } if ($this->hashtag != '') $score += 2; if ($this->contest_id != 0) $score += 2; // $score = $score + floor($this->pageview / 1000) * 0; $userId = $this->user_id; $score += $this->likes->filter(function($like) use ($userId) { return $userId != $like->user_id; })->count() * 10; if ($this->comments->filter(function($comment) use ($userId) { return $userId != $comment->user_id; })->count() > 0) { $score += 10; } if ($score >= 10) { $this->trending_score = $score; } else { $this->trending_score = 0; } if ($this->is_sensitive) { $this->trending_score = 0; } $this->save(); } ``` 拋磚引玉,歡迎大家多多利用這個專區交流~ 謝謝大家~
6
個讚
2留言
275瀏覽
檢舉
6
個讚
2留言
275瀏覽
檢舉
站長阿川
🌏
·
3年前
RAILS之父:我怎麼學會寫程式的?
DHH,本名David Heinemeier Hansson,Basecamp合夥人、Google 2005年度駭客、業餘賽車手,他最知名的身份是網路開發框架Ruby on Rails的發明者。 http://blog.turn.tw/wp-content/uploads/2014/10/David-Heinemeier-Hansson.jpg DHH曾在部落格發表他學寫程式的心得: https://signalvnoise.com/posts/2582-how-do-i-learn-to-program 看過之後覺得獲益良多,特此翻譯出來和大家分享。 **我怎麼學會寫程式的?** 我花了二十幾年才真的學會怎麼寫程式。不是因為我嘗試的不夠,而是因為我一直用錯誤的方法。我以前都看著那些教材、範本照做,寫出一些我根本沒興趣繼續往下寫的東西。這是為了學習而學習。 我知道這方法對有些人管用,這些人就是很樂意學習新東西。我真羨慕你們。但這對我不管用,而且我知道很多人也沒辦法用這種方式學習。 為了解決鳥事而寫程式———對我來說這才管用。寫程式是因為非這麼做不可。寫程式是因為我他媽的在乎自己所寫的東西,而且我希望它越快完成越好。 這就是我學寫Ruby的方法。我把目標定為,用Ruby把Basecamp寫出來。當你因為一個目標而去學習,每件事的先後順序就變得非常清楚。我到底該做什麼才能讓這幾個訊息順利在Ruby執行?哦,我需要在這裡加一個迴圈。哦,我需要在哪裡抓些資料庫的資料出來。 決定目標的當下,你的點子就完成一半了、而且你還知道了該怎麼做。 簡單來說,就是從一些確實的東西開始做起,接著讓時鐘發出「滴」聲,然後讓它發出「答」聲。
4
個讚
1留言
252瀏覽
檢舉
4
個讚
1留言
252瀏覽
檢舉
站長阿川
🌏
·
3年前
此部落已連結創作區的「靠北工程師」投稿分類~
慶祝成立部落~ 站長連結了相關頁面~ https://memes.tw/wtf?contest=12 這個投稿分類的頁面會顯示這個部落 這個部落下方也會顯示投稿相關圖片~ 希望讓同好更容易聚集、交流哦~
1
個讚
0留言
170瀏覽
檢舉
1
個讚
0留言
170瀏覽
檢舉
站長阿川
🌏
·
3年前
梗圖倉庫大部份模組使用的熱門演算法公式
網站很多地方都有用到「熱門」的排序 目前站長是用一個簡單的公式,未來可能會再改成比較複雜的公式 跟大家分享目前的公式 ``` function refreshTrendingScore() { if ($this->approved_at < \Carbon\Carbon::now()->subHours( 24 * trending_image_beginning_live_days() + $this->total_like_count * trending_image_extra_hours_per_like() )) { $this->trending_score = 0; $this->save(); return; } $score = 0; if ($this->user_id != 0) { $score += 100; if ($this->user->intro) $score += 2; if ($this->user->photo) $score += 2; if ($this->user->created_at >= \Carbon\Carbon::now()->subDays(2) || $this->user->wtf_total_count < 4) { $score += 4; } } if ($this->hashtag != '') $score += 2; if ($this->contest_id != 0) $score += 2; // $score = $score + floor($this->pageview / 1000) * 0; $userId = $this->user_id; $score += $this->likes->filter(function($like) use ($userId) { return $userId != $like->user_id; })->count() * 10; if ($this->comments->filter(function($comment) use ($userId) { return $userId != $comment->user_id; })->count() > 0) { $score += 10; } if ($score >= 10) { $this->trending_score = $score; } else { $this->trending_score = 0; } if ($this->is_sensitive) { $this->trending_score = 0; } $this->save(); } ``` 是一個很簡單好用的小小熱門公式 跟大家分享唷~
4
個讚
1留言
252瀏覽
檢舉
4
個讚
1留言
252瀏覽
檢舉
站長阿川
🌏
·
3年前
大家會好奇梗圖倉庫的某些演算法 or 架構 or 技術工具嗎?
如題~ 不知道大家會不會好奇網站的一些技術細節呢? 演算法 or 架構 or 技術工具之類的? 話題部落的文章是支援張貼程式碼格式的~(syntax highlighting) 歡迎大家在部落這邊自由提問~ 站長有空都會盡量回答唷~
6
個讚
1留言
286瀏覽
檢舉
6
個讚
1留言
286瀏覽
檢舉
投稿到「靠北工程師」的創作區梗圖
程式設計討論
程式設計、軟體工程相關的自由交流區~
……
展開全文
程式設計、軟體工程相關的自由交流區~
8
位
部落成員
5
則
部落貼文
加入部落
發表貼文
建立日期:2021年06月20日
程式設計討論
程式設計、軟體工程相關的自由交流區~
8
位
部落成員
5
則
部落貼文
加入部落
發表貼文
建立日期:2021年06月20日
Switch Language:
繁體中文
简体中文
English
International Version:
English
日本語
한국어
Bahasa Indonesia
ไทย
Tiếng Việt
Tagalog
español
русский
[DEBUG]
梗圖倉庫 © 2024
本網站為線上梗圖製作技術平台,僅提供圖片編輯技術,並不提供圖片與文字內容。所有圖片與文字均由網友提供,本站無法即時審查網友上傳內容。有發現任何問題請聯絡站長。
歡迎加入梗圖倉庫
×
梗圖倉庫是台灣最大梗圖專門網站。提供每日有趣梗圖,還有超多梗圖產生器讓你輕鬆玩!
用 Facebook 帳號登入
或是用 Email
註冊新帳號
已經有帳號了?
點此登入
檢舉不當內容
×
您需要先註冊登入,才能使用此功能。
點此前往登入
加到主題包
×
加到圖包
×
加到精選
×